Description

This week, Eliza shares the story of Kat, a student from New York, and how she stays gently connected to Korean in her everyday routine — even with a busy work schedule.


No pressure. No long study blocks.
Just small, consistent moments that make Korean feel like part of her real life — not just a subject.


In This Episode:



  • Kat’s 3-step daily Korean rhythm (no “studying” required)

  • Why one sentence a day can be enough

  • Easy phrases you can whisper to yourself — and still improve

  • Vocabulary highlights from Kat’s story


Vocab Highlights:



  • 혼잣말로 말하다 — to speak to oneself

  • 입모양으로 따라 하다 — to mouth or repeat quietly

  • 야경 — night view
